The Importance of Game Theory

Game theory provides a mathematical framework for analyzing strategic interactions. It’s particularly relevant in competitive gaming scenarios where the outcome depends on the decisions of multiple players. Concepts such as Nash equilibrium – a stable state where no player can improve their outcome by unilaterally changing their strategy – are frequently observed in high-level play. Understanding these principles can help players anticipate optimal responses and formulate strategies that maximize their chances of success. For example, in a head-to-head competition, players might adopt a mixed strategy, randomly choosing between different options to avoid being predictable. This introduces an element of uncertainty that makes it more difficult for the opponent to exploit their weaknesses.

Furthermore, game theory helps players assess risk and reward. A seemingly aggressive move might offer a high potential payoff but also carry a significant risk of failure. By quantifying these factors, players can make more informed decisions about when to take calculated risks and when to play it safe. This analytical approach is particularly crucial in games with significant financial stakes, where a single miscalculation can have substantial consequences. Applying game theory principles isn’t simply about calculating odds; it's about understanding the psychological motivations of opponents and exploiting their potential biases.
